The D4s are not really made for really nearfield listening. I tried putting mine on my computer desk and it didn't sound right.

What you want are the DS4.5. They have a similar tonal balance, but are designed to be listening to super nearfield. I use these and an iDecco for my computer desk and the setup is fantastic.
